Transaction 3a84c81b250d60bf40493837ce6d2bf0d64b33f65112aa91a002d4cdacaa9f12
1 Input
1 Output
-
3a84c81b250d60bf40493837ce6d2bf0d64b33f65112aa91a002d4cdacaa9f12:0
- value
- 10336786
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22d75cbb864aac1253829fa29ba5be77b0d67be5 OP_EQUAL
- address
- 34sEthMHmKikDpkLiEZfqAWYbGcexto2q1